Cash on Demand Systems
One morning over my usual mug of coffee, I switched over to the “Entrepreneur Channel” on Sky (UK Satellite TV Provider) to see a guy presenting his “Cash on Demand” system. This apparent step-by-step system would be delivered monthly through the door (the old-fashioned way) and have me starting my own business by the end of a year. This seemed to be exactly what I needed!
My fiancée said that she would pay for the course for me as it looked like it could hold the answers that I’d looked long and hard trying to find. The guy looked trust-worthy and he was on the telly! What more convincing would I need? Excited that I had finally found a way to start my own business, with guaranteed results in less than 12 months and a payment plan where I could pay monthly, I ordered the course.
With each part that arrived I hoped for the step-by-step system to start as had been promised. I was looking forward to getting started, but month after month went by and after 5 months and 5 course parts I was still unable to get started due to insufficient information. I contacted the person who had written the course and shared my concerns with them. I was told that the course would start getting interesting from part 6 – the next part, so I waited.
Part 6 eventually arrived and the content was again unusable. What was promised at the end of each part was severely under-delivered in the next part. And after a year I still hadn’t started my business and still didn’t know where to start. I was invited to keep sending my payments of £30 per month for a further 12 months, in order to receive the next 12 parts of the course. This went against what was previously advertised and published in part 1 where it was stated that I would be able to start my own business within 12 months. This was certainly not true.
I investigated this particular course and loads of other people were in the same boat and had been living part to part of false promises that were never delivered. And although the course author had made over £30 Million doing this and other business ventures, it became very clear that they were extremely similar to that “Snake-Oil” salesman of long ago. There ended up being over 24 parts to the course! During these 12 months, I received no end of other offers asking me to buy other products and seminars for £5,000 – £9,000 ($3,000 – $5,500)! Ridiculous!
It became clear that the course had been written in 2005. It is now 2009 and that same course is still available, when everything has moved on and the “System” is no longer as relevant to today’s market as it may have been then.
